Hainaut Stadium, Football stadium in Valenciennes, France
Hainaut Stadium is a modern football venue with two tiers featuring an exterior covered with steel panels arranged in a geometric pattern. The facility accommodates around 25,000 spectators across multiple seating sections surrounding the pitch.
The venue opened in 2011 and replaced the older Stade Nungesser following the club's rise to the top division in 2006. The new construction represented a major turning point for both the team and the city.
Supporters of Valenciennes FC gather here during home matches, creating an energetic environment that shapes the team's identity in the city. The venue has become central to the local football community.
The facility offers electronic payment options at concession stands and shops throughout the venue. Access points near entrances G and H lead directly to food and merchandise locations for visitor convenience.
The main stand's glass facade stands out from the rest of the structure, as it lacks the characteristic steel panels seen elsewhere. This design choice makes it the most visually distinct feature of the building.
